The Levi Panorama is set high on a snowy hillside, with excellent ski slopes and Levi village on your doorstep.
If you haven’t already guessed by the name, cinematic views are what this place majors in. Everything from the restaurants to the seventh-floor saunas look out over the snow-dusted landscape.
The property is wedged into the white stuff on the side of a fell that leads down to Levi – a ski lift connects you to the village. Its slope-side position puts you in touching distance of Finland’s top ski and snowboard runs.

ARRIVE IN KITTILA
You’ll get a traditional cooked English breakfast on your flight to Lapland. Once you’ve landed at Kittila Airport, you’ll be greeted by Santa’s elves who will whisk you off to collect your thermal clothing before taking you to your hotel. The afternoon’s free for you to get a feel for the place.
-
TASTER SESSIONS AND TIME TO MEET SANTA
Today you’ll head out to Santa’s activity area in the Kittila countryside for a day of festive fun. You’ll head out on a short husky-sledge ride, or a snowmobile sleigh ride. For something at a slower pace, you can try your hand at making Christmas ornaments. A visit to Santa tops off this action-packed day out.
-
FREE TIME/FESTIVE FINALE
The day’s yours to explore today. You can get involved in a snowball fight, or book a trip and head out on a husky or reindeer-driven sleigh. If you’re staying for four nights, there’s an option to add on a hunt for the Northern Lights, too – just make sure you book in your TUI experiences before you go so you don’t risk missing out. For those on a three-night trip, it’s time to hand your thermal clothing in today before your festive finale, which will feature a traditional Christmas dinner with all the trimmings.
-
FLY HOME/FESTIVE FINALE
Whether you stayed for three or four nights, you’ll get a festive Christmas dinner on your flight back home. If you’re on a three-night trip, it’s time to head back to the airport today for your flight home. Or, if you’re staying for four nights, you’ll have a free day to explore and fit in anything else you’ve missed earlier on in your stay. Later, it’s time to hand your thermal clothing in before your festive finale this evening.
-
FLY HOME
For those on a four-night trip it’s time to head back to the airport today, ready for your flight home.
